dac8512fz Analog Devices, Inc., dac8512fz Datasheet - Page 19

no-image

dac8512fz

Manufacturer Part Number
dac8512fz
Description
+5 V, Serial Input Complete 12-bit Dac
Manufacturer
Analog Devices, Inc.
Datasheet
REV. A
TFRLP
*
WAIT
*
*
*Update DAC output with contents of DAC register
*
*
LDAA
STAA
LDAA
BPL
INX
CPX
BNE
BCLR
BSET
BSET
PULA When done, restore registers X, Y & A
PULY
PULX
RTS
0,X
SPDR
SPSR
WAIT
#SDI2+1
TFRLP
PORTD,Y
PORTD,Y
PORTC,Y
Get a byte to transfer via SPI
Write SDI data reg to start xfer
Loop to wait for SPIF
SPIF is the MSB of SPSR
(when SPIF is set, SPSR is negated)
Increment counter to next byte for xfer
Are we done yet ?
If not, xfer the second byte
$20 Assert LD/
$20 Latch DAC register
$01 De-assert CS/
** Return to Main Program **
–19–
DAC8512

Related parts for dac8512fz